Sweet & Sour Pork With Cashews |
|
 |
Prep Time: 30 Minutes Cook Time: 0 Minutes |
Ready In: 30 Minutes Servings: 4 |
|
Another yummy and healthy recipe! Ingredients:
2 tablespoons cornstarch, divided |
1 tablespoon sherry wine |
1 lb pork tenderloin, cut into 1-inch pieces |
1/4 cup sugar |
1/3 cup water |
1/4 cup cider vinegar |
3 tablespoons soy sauce |
3 tablespoons ketchup |
1 tablespoon canola oil |
1/3 cup unsalted cashews |
1/4 cup green onion, chopped |
2 garlic cloves, minced |
2 teaspoons fresh gingerroot, minced |
3 cups snow peas |
1 (8 ounce) can pineapple chunks, drained |
hot cooked rice |
Directions:
1. In a large bowl, combine 1 TBS cornstarch and sherry until smooth; add pork and toss to coat. 2. In another bowl, combine sugar and remaining cornstarch. Stir in the water, vinegar, soy sauce and ketchup until smooth, set aside. 3. In a large skillet or wok, stir-fry pork in hot oil until no longer pink. 4. Add cashews, onion, garlic and ginger; stir-fry 1 minute. 5. Add peas and pineapple; stir-fry until peas are crisp-tender, about 3 minutes. 6. Stir cornstarch mixture and add to pan. Bring to a boil; cook and stir 1-2 minutes until sauce is thickened. 7. Serve over rice. |
